Vitamin C: A Powerful Antioxidant for Immune Support

Vitamin C, also known as ascorbic acid, is an essential nutrient that plays a crucial role in supporting immune function. It is a powerful antioxidant that helps protect against oxidative stress caused by harmful molecules called free radicals. Vitamin C is also involved in the production of white blood cells, which play a critical role in fighting off infections.

Research suggests that vitamin C may have potential in preventing and treating respiratory infections, such as COVID-19. A recent study showed that high doses of intravenous vitamin C improved the outcomes of patients with severe cases of COVID-19.

While more research is needed to confirm its effectiveness, getting enough vitamin C through diet or supplements is still important for overall immune system support.

Food sources of vitamin C: citrus fruits (like oranges and grapefruits) kiwi fruit strawberries pineapple broccoli red and green peppers

It is recommended that adults consume 75-90 mg of vitamin C per day. However, some experts suggest that higher doses may be necessary for optimal immune support, especially during times of increased stress or illness.

Vitamin D: Essential for Immune Function

In addition to vitamin C, another crucial vitamin for immune system support is vitamin D. Vitamin D is essential for proper immune function, playing a key role in activating immune cells that help fight off infections. Research has also suggested that maintaining adequate levels of vitamin D may reduce the risk of respiratory infections like COVID-19.

Unfortunately, many people have vitamin D deficiency, especially those who live in areas with limited sunlight or who do not spend enough time outdoors. Additionally, older adults and those with darker skin may have a harder time producing vitamin D naturally.

Food Sources of Vitamin D Amount of Vitamin D (IU) per Serving
Fatty Fish (Salmon, Tuna, Mackerel) 400-1000
Egg Yolks 40
Cheese 40
Mushrooms 400

While it can be difficult to obtain adequate vitamin D from food alone, taking supplements can help ensure sufficient levels. The recommended daily intake for vitamin D varies based on age and other factors, but most adults can aim for 600-800 IU per day.

It is important to note that excessive intake of vitamin D supplements can be harmful, so it is best to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any supplement regimen.

Essential Vitamins and Nutrients for Virus Prevention

While vitamin C and vitamin D are crucial for immune system support and virus prevention, they are not the only vitamins and nutrients that play a role in protecting against infections. Other essential vitamins and minerals include:

Vitamin A Vitamin E Zinc
Vitamin A is important for maintaining the health of the mucous membranes in the nose and throat, which act as barriers to viruses and bacteria. It also plays a role in the production of white blood cells, which are essential for fighting infections. Vitamin E is a powerful antioxidant that helps to protect the body from damage caused by free radicals. It also plays a role in regulating immune function. Zinc is necessary for the development and function of immune cells. It also helps to protect the body against infections by supporting the production of antibodies and reducing inflammation.

It is important to note that while taking vitamin supplements can be beneficial, it is best to obtain these essential vitamins and minerals through a well-balanced diet. Good sources of vitamin A include sweet potatoes, carrots, and spinach. Vitamin E can be found in nuts, seeds, and vegetable oils. Zinc is abundant in oysters, lean meats, and legumes.

By ensuring that one’s diet includes a variety of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ins, individuals can obtain the essential vitamins and minerals needed for a strong immune system and effective virus prevention.

Section 12: Maintaining Good Hygiene Practices

It is important to remember that while vitamins and supplements can support the immune system, they should not replace essential preventive measures. The most effective way to prevent the spread of COVID-19 is by practicing good hygiene.

This includes frequent handwashing with soap and water for at least 20 seconds, or using an alcohol-based hand sanitizer when soap and water are not available. It is also important to avoid touching one’s face, especially the mouth, nose, and eyes, as this can introduce the virus into the body.

Wearing masks or face coverings in public settings, especially when physical distancing is difficult, is also crucial in preventing the spread of COVID-19. Masks help to prevent droplets from the mouth and nose that may contain the virus from spreading to others.

It is important to stay informed and follow official guidelines from health authorities for preventing the spread of COVID-19.
